Key Responsibilities
- Lead the geotechnical design and delivery of projects from feasibility through to construction.
- Undertake and review geotechnical assessments, including foundation design, retaining walls, earthworks and slope stability analysis.
- Provide technical oversight and guidance to junior engineers and engineering teams.
- Manage ground investigation programmes and interpret geotechnical data.
- Produce and review factual and interpretative geotechnical reports.
- Liaise directly with clients, contractors and multidisciplinary design teams.
- Prepare fee proposals, project programmes and technical specifications.
- Ensure projects are delivered on time, within budget and to the highest technical standards.
- Support business development activities and contribute to winning new work.
Requirements
- Degree in Civil Engineering, Geology, Engineering Geology or a related discipline.
- Chartered or working towards Chartership with a relevant professional body.
- Extensive experience within a geotechnical consultancy environment.
- Strong background in geotechnical design and analysis.
- Experience using industry-standard software such as Plaxis, GeoStudio, Oasys Suite, Wallap or equivalent.
- Proven ability to manage multiple projects and stakeholders.
- Excellent technical reporting and communication skills.
- Experience mentoring and developing junior engineers.
